About the role
- Lead negotiations for complex global SaaS and infrastructure deals (>$1M).
- Manage simultaneous compliance requirements across U.S., EU, and APAC (GDPR, CCPA, China DSL, PIPL, etc.).
- Negotiate cloud hyperscaler agreements (AWS, Azure, GCP).
- Structure open-core monetization models across Cloud and On-Premise offerings.
- Apply hands-on commercial expertise across at least two of three regions: U.S., EMEA, and APAC.
- Accelerate GTM execution by enhancing customer trust, reducing sales contract cycles, and structuring scalable partner ecosystem contracts.
- Provide legal insights on competitive landscapes that influence business strategy.
- Partner with Product to co-design data product terms and conditions, and develop scalable open-source compliance engines.
- Lead distributed legal teams across three or more time zones; implement “follow-the-sun” legal operations.
- Scale legal output efficiently with limited headcount growth using tools like CLM automation.
- Resolve complex multi-jurisdictional incidents and risks with speed and precision.
- Demonstrate a growth mindset by upskilling the legal team on emerging technologies and new business models.
- Navigate cross-cultural dynamics across the U.S. and Asia; adapt leadership style for Sales, Product, and Engineering teams.
- Exhibit proactive ownership—crafting and executing a global legal roadmap that aligns with business scaling needs.
- Maintain strong professional standing with Bar admission and participation in relevant legal associations.
Requirements
- 12+ years of progressive legal experience, with at least 5 years in leadership roles within SaaS, infrastructure, or high-tech companies.
- Proven track record negotiating high-value SaaS/infra contracts, cloud hyperscaler agreements, and structuring open-core models.
- Deep knowledge of global compliance frameworks (GDPR, CCPA, China DSL, PIPL) and experience managing cross-border compliance simultaneously.
- Experience managing distributed global legal teams and implementing operational systems to scale efficiency.
- Strong commercial acumen with experience embedded in GTM and Product functions.
- Crisis management expertise, handling multi-jurisdictional risks and incidents.
- Exceptional communication and cross-cultural collaboration skills.
- Active Bar membership.
